如果该内容未能解决您的问题,您可以点击反馈按钮或发送邮件联系人工。或添加QQ群:1381223

JDK 15 下载指南:全面解析与应用

JDK 15 下载指南:全面解析与应用

JDK 15 是由Oracle公司发布的Java开发工具包(Java Development Kit)的最新版本之一。作为Java生态系统中的重要组成部分,JDK 15带来了许多新特性和改进,吸引了众多开发者的关注。本文将为大家详细介绍JDK 15下载的相关信息,并列举其在实际应用中的一些案例。

JDK 15的下载与安装

首先,JDK 15下载可以通过Oracle官网进行。访问Oracle的Java下载页面,选择JDK 15版本。下载页面会提供不同操作系统的安装包,包括Windows、Linux和macOS。下载完成后,根据操作系统的不同,安装步骤也略有差异:

  • Windows:双击下载的安装包,按照提示完成安装。
  • Linux:解压缩tar.gz文件,然后配置环境变量。
  • macOS:下载.dmg文件,打开后拖动JDK到应用程序文件夹。

安装完成后,可以通过命令行工具java -version来验证安装是否成功。

JDK 15的新特性

JDK 15 引入了许多新特性和改进,包括但不限于:

  1. 文本块(Text Blocks):简化了多行字符串的编写,使代码更易读。
  2. 模式匹配(Pattern Matching):增强了switch表达式和语句的功能。
  3. 隐藏类(Hidden Classes):提供了一种新的类加载机制,提高了安全性和性能。
  4. JVM常量API:提供了对常量的更细粒度的控制。
  5. ZGC增强:Z Garbage Collector的进一步优化,减少了GC暂停时间。

这些特性不仅提升了开发效率,还为Java应用的性能和安全性提供了新的可能。

JDK 15的应用场景

JDK 15 在实际应用中有着广泛的用途:

  1. 企业级应用开发:许多大型企业应用,如ERP系统、CRM系统等,都依赖于Java技术。JDK 15的新特性可以帮助这些系统在性能和功能上得到提升。

  2. 微服务架构:随着微服务架构的流行,Java的Spring Boot框架结合JDK 15的特性,可以更高效地构建和部署微服务。

  3. 大数据处理:Java在Hadoop、Spark等大数据处理框架中占据重要地位。JDK 15的性能优化对于处理大规模数据集尤为重要。

  4. 移动应用开发:虽然Android开发主要使用Android SDK,但许多后端服务和工具仍然依赖于Java。JDK 15的改进可以提高这些服务的稳定性和性能。

  5. 云计算:Java在云计算环境中广泛应用,JDK 15的特性如ZGC的优化,使得在云端运行的Java应用能够更好地利用资源。

注意事项

在下载和使用JDK 15时,需要注意以下几点:

  • 兼容性:确保你的项目或应用与JDK 15兼容,特别是如果使用了第三方库或框架。
  • 许可证:Oracle JDK的许可证有变化,个人开发者和小型团队可能需要考虑使用OpenJDK版本。
  • 升级策略:如果从旧版本升级到JDK 15,建议先在测试环境中进行,以确保所有功能正常运行。

总结

JDK 15 作为Java生态系统中的重要更新,带来了许多令人兴奋的新特性和性能提升。通过本文的介绍,希望大家对JDK 15下载及其应用有了一个全面的了解。无论你是Java开发新手还是经验丰富的开发者,JDK 15都值得一试,它将为你的开发工作带来新的可能性和效率提升。记得在下载和使用时遵守相关法律法规,确保软件的合法使用。